Information about the School
Stourview CofE Primary Academy is an exciting and forward-thinking primary school located in Mistley, Essex.
Formerly known as Mistley Norman, we are undergoing a significant transformation as part of the government's School Rebuilding Programme. While our state-of-the-art new building is under construction, our pupils are thriving in a modern modular facility that ensures continuity and quality in their education.
As part of our evolution, we recently joined Canonium Learning Trust, a dynamic and supportive education trust specialising in small, rural, and village schools across North and Mid Essex. This partnership strengthens our commitment to delivering exceptional education while fostering collaboration and professional development for our staff.
As a proud Church of England school, guided by the vision to educate for "life in all its fullness" (John 10:10), our school places equal importance on spiritual, physical, intellectual, emotional, moral, and social development. We aim to nurture knowledgeable, thoughtful, and articulate individuals equipped with the values and cultural capital to succeed in an ever-evolving world.
At Stourview, we are proud of our inclusive and welcoming community, underpinned by our core Christian values of respect, compassion, honesty, perseverance, and responsibility. Our ambitious vision, coupled with the support of Canonium Learning Trust, marks the start of an exciting new era for our school, staff, and pupils.
